Fly Fishing 101: A Beginner's Guide to Tying on Success

Embarking on a journey into the captivating world of fly fishing can feel challenging at first. Mastering the art of casting and choosing the right flies requires patience and practice, but the rewards are immeasurable. This article will provide you with some fundamental techniques to help you start your fly fishing adventure on the right foot.

  • Understanding your gear is paramount. Learn about your rod, reel, line weight, and different types of flies to ensure a harmonious blend.
  • Practice your casting form in an open space. Start with short, controlled casts and gradually increase the distance as you gain confidence.
  • Presenting your fly naturally is key to enticing a strike. Practice different mend techniques to imitate the movement of insects.

Remember, fly fishing is a skill that takes time and dedication to master. Don't be discouraged by early setbacks. Embrace the learning process, experiment with different approaches, and most importantly, enjoy the serenity and beauty of being on the water.
